  • Abstract
    An improved wideband flat characteristic has been obtained using lumped element microwave coupler. The cutoff frequency has been increased by cascading two individual sections of microwave couplers, and the cascading of three individual sections of microwave coupler has further improved the bandwidth. The cutoff frequencies fc for one section, two sections and three section microwave coupler are 573.25 MHz, 810.74 MHz and 859.90 MHz respectively. The results have been verified mathematically and also by means of simulation through Microwave Office of Applied Wave Research (AWR).
